Adopting a religious perspective can help you control your anger. Regardless of the religion, all of them preach self control and anger management in one way or the other. For example, Christians believe that its a sin to unable to control your anger. There are also many biblical sayings and quotes that show the dangers of uncontrollable anger. When you meditate on such religious instructions related to anger, you can calm down enough to think rationally. I know how difficult it can be to manage anger. But it can be simple if you decide to make it simple. Didnt they say we are in control of our emotions all the time? I tend to agree with this statement because its within everyones power to get angry or not to get angry. When you think of the negative impact of anger, you will be convinced to NOT get angry as often as you are provoked. Getting angry does not make you a bad person. What casts you in a negative light however is the way you choose to express that anger. Being abusive or vindictive are negative ways of displaying anger. You can decide to keep quiet when you are angered or silently and politely walk away, instead of lashing out at the object or subject of the anger. This works far better than losing your temper. Empathizing with the person who makes you angry is one fine anger management technique. When you wear the shoes of your protagonist and feel the pinch, you will be more inclined to forgive any slight on his or her part. Empathy- the process of empathizing with the person who angers you is fast becoming a popular anger management technique. You dont have to be right all the time. Instead of provoking and being provoked because of the need to win an argument, you can simply concede for the sake of peace. Its true that lots of outbursts of anger starts with arguments that end up badly. You dont have to proof a point or show that your argument is superior all the time. Your opponents wont accept it and this will only make you angry more often.
